Restored 'The Washington House' to Open in Ridge Tavern Building

One of the most recognizable buildings in Basking Ridge, The Ridge Tavern — which for decades had been The Store — is undergoing restoration and is due to open with an establishment more faithful to its original design.

Robin McKeon Appointed School Board President, Elaine Kusel is VP

One way or another, two new board members moved into top leadership roles on the Bernards Township Board of Education at its first meeting of the year. The board next plans to appoint a new member to replace Audrey Sherwyn, who is moving, and had previously served as board vice-president. New board member Christopher Viereck also was sworn onto the board.

Ridge Baseball Club Request to Turf Infield at Baseball Complex Remains at Stalemate

The Ridge Baseball Club wants to install synthetic turf fields at the township owned baseball complex off Valley Road — but township officials say they first want a conclusive solution to overflow parking.

New Mayor Schedules Two 'Brown Bag' Lunches With Open Invite to Residents

Bernards Township's 2014 Mayor John Carpenter has scheduled his first 'brown bag' informal lunch to chat with township residents at the Somerset Hills YMCA on Jan. 25.
